Do you love God?

No man hath seen God at any time. If we love one another, God dwelleth in us, and his love is perfected in us.


¶ I JOHN 4 : 12

 

What is your attitude about love? Is it simply an emotion, or a good feeling? Or do you sing with Tina…"What’s love got to do with it?"? As Christians, we are called to love one another, and to love those around us. Love is a dominant feature of a Christian, or at least it should be. There are too many "Christians" who say that they love God, but their life is spent to bring themselves pleasure. Today’s verse starts our by saying, "No man hath seen God at any time." John was making a point here. Later in verse 20 of John 4 it says, "If a man say, I love God, and hateth his brother, he is a liar: for he that loveth not his brother whom he hath seen, how can he love God whom he hath not seen?". How can a person claim to love God, whom he hasn’t seen, and hate someone alive that he has seen. The Bible is very clear on how we show our love for God, and that is by showing His love to others! Jesus said, "If ye love me, keep my commandments." John 14:15 and "He that hath my commandments, and keepeth them, he it is that loveth me: and he that loveth me shall be loved of my Father, and I will love him, and will manifest myself to him." in John 14:21. Our love for God is shown when we "keep His commandments" and He has commanded us to "love one another".

 

Now, the big question, should we love one another just because God tells us to, in other words, is love simply something that we have to do? NO!!!! Our motivation for loving should come from a thankful heart in response to God’s amazing demonstration of love by sending Jesus to die on the cross for you and me. 1 John 4:10 says, "Herein is love, not that we loved God, but that he loved us, and sent his Son to be the propitiation for our sins." When we were destitute, and definitely undeserving, God sent Jesus to die for you and me. He sent Him to pay for sins that He would NEVER commit, so that you could have that relationship with Him. And here is how you know if you have that relationship with Him, or not. "We know that we have passed from death unto life, because we love the brethren. He that loveth not his brother abideth in death." 1 John 3:14
